language: Add `LanguageName::new_static` to reduce allocations (#44380)
Click to expand commit body
Implements a specialized constructor `LanguageName::new_static` for
`&'static str` which reduces allocations.
`LanguageName::new` always backs the underlying `SharedString` with an
owned `Arc<str>` even when a `&'static str` is passed. This makes us
allocate each time we create a new `LanguageName` no matter what.
Creating a specialized constructor for `&'static str` allows us to
essentially construct them for free.
Additional change:
Encourages using explicit constructors to avoid needless allocations.
Currently there were no instances of this trait being called where the
lifetime was not `'static` saving another 48 locations of allocation.
```rust
impl<'a> From<&'a str> for LanguageName {
fn from(str: &'a str) -> Self {
Self(SharedString::new(str))
}
}
// to
impl From<&'static str> for LanguageName {
fn from(str: &'static str) -> Self {
Self(SharedString::new_static(str))
}
}
```

extensions: Don't recompile Tree-sitter parsers when up-to-date (#43442)
Click to expand commit body
When installing local "dev" extensions that provide tree-sitter
grammars, compiling the parser can be quite intensive[^anecdote]. This
PR changes the logic to only compile the parser if the WASM object
doesn't exist or the source files are newer than the object (just like
`make(1)` would do).
[^anecdote]: The tree-sitter parser for LLVM IR takes >10 minutes to
compile and uses 20 GB of memory on my laptop.

macos: Reset exception ports for shell-spawned processes (#44193)
Click to expand commit body
## Summary
Follow-up to #40716. This applies the same `reset_exception_ports()` fix
to `set_pre_exec_to_start_new_session()`, which is used by shell
environment capture, terminal spawning, and DAP transport.
### Root Cause
After more debugging, I finally figured out what was causing the issue
on my machine. Here's what was happening:
1. Zed spawns a login shell (zsh) to capture environment variables
2. A pipe is created: reader in Zed, writer mapped to fd 0 in zsh
3. zsh sources `.zshrc` → loads oh-my-zsh → runs poetry plugin
4. Poetry plugin runs `poetry completions zsh &|` in background
5. Poetry inherits fd 0 (the pipe's write end) from zsh
6. zsh finishes `zed --printenv` and exits
7. Poetry still holds fd 0 open
8. Zed's `reader.read_to_end()` blocks waiting for all writers to close
9. Poetry hangs (likely due to inherited crash handler exception ports
interfering with its normal operation)
10. Pipe stays open → Zed stuck → no more processes spawn (including
LSPs)
I confirmed this by killing the hanging `poetry` process, which
immediately unblocked Zed and allowed LSPs to start. However, this
workaround was needed every time I started Zed.
While poetry was the culprit in my case, this can affect any shell
configuration that spawns background processes during initialization
(oh-my-zsh plugins, direnv, asdf, nvm, etc.).

debugger: Fix stack frame filter not persisting between sessions (#44352)
Click to expand commit body
This bug was caused by using two separate keys for writing/reading from
the KVP database. The bug didn't show up in my debug build because there
was an old entry of a valid key.
I added an integration test for this feature to prevent future
regressions as well.
